Upland Dr, St. Louis, Missouri - Redfin
9 addresses found on Upland Dr in St. Louis, Missouri. The average lot size on Upland Dr is 5629 sq. ft. The average property tax on Upland Dr is $1.9K/yr. Find an address below to learn more about the property details:
- 9405 Upland Dr, Saint Louis, MO 63123
- 9533 Upland Dr, Saint Louis, MO 63123
- 9429 Upland Dr, Saint Louis, MO 63123
- 9438 Upland Dr, Saint Louis, MO 63123
- 9433 Upland Dr, Saint Louis, MO 63123
- 9516 Upland Dr, Saint Louis, MO 63123
- 9505 Upland Dr, Saint Louis, MO 63123
- 9537 Upland Dr, Saint Louis, MO 63123
- 9517 Upland Dr, Saint Louis, MO 63123